U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service, Anchorage, AK has a requirement for a commercial item or service. This combined synopsis/solicitation is prepared in accordance with the format in FAR Subpart 12.6 (as supplemented with additional information included in this notice). This posting will be referred to under Request for Quotation (RFQ) Number 140F0719Q0041.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ation. A written solicitation will be issued and attached to this posting for reference only. This RFQ falls under procedures in FAR Parts 12 and 13. This document incorporates provisions and clauses updated by way of the Federal Acquisition Circular (FAC) 2019-04, effective August 7, 2019. This requirement is set aside for small businesses. The North American Industrial Classification System (NAICS) number is 541714, Research and Development in Biotechnology (except Nanobiotechnology) and the business size standard is 1,000 Employees. This announcement constitutes the Government's only official notice of this procurement. The Government does not intend to pay for any information provided under this synopsis.

The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service is requesting quotes for DNA Metabarcoding of mixed environmental samples (Qty of 240 samples)

The basis for award is Best Value to the government.
